Уведомления по электронной почте
Зачем нужны эти уведомления
Система LICANT-IT автоматически отправляет письма в случае важных для пользователей событий. Уведомления не могут быть созданы пользователем под нужное ему событие самостоятельно, но для существующих уведомлений пользователь может изменить содержимое шаблона.
На данный момент в LICANT-IT существуют следующие уведомления для пользователей:
- уведомление об изменении информации серийного номера;
- уведомление о выходе нового релиза продукта;
- напоминание о скором окончании подписки;
- уведомление о фактическом завершении подписки;
- выдача нового серийного номера;
- оповещение о добавлении аккаунта на портал;
- восстановление пароля;
Также есть одно уведомление для администратора:
- уведомление об изменении профиля пользователя.
Все тексты шаблонов можно редактировать в Панели администратора в соответствующем разделе (слева) LICANT → Шаблоны email.

В каждом шаблоне есть поля для адресатов, для HTML контент шаблона, а снизу отображается список доступных переменных полей.
Существующие в LICANT-IT Шаблоны писем
1. serial_updated - уведомление об изменении информации серийного номера
Тема по умолчанию:
Изменены параметры лицензии {{ serial.product }}
Назначение: уведомление владельцу лицензии о том, что в серийном номере были изменены параметры.
Когда отправляется: при редактировании серийного номера в Панели администратора, если установлен флажок «Оповестить владельца об изменении информации».
Какие изменения отслеживаются:
- количество лицензий;
- дата начала;
- дата окончания.
Если отмечен флажок уведомления, но ни одно из этих полей фактически не изменилось, письмо не отправляется.
В письмо попадают только реально изменённые поля.
2. new_release - уведомление о выходе нового релиза продукта
Тема по умолчанию: Новый релиз {{ product.name }}
Назначение: информирование пользователей о публикации нового релиза продукта (с номером релиза, датой, типами продукта и историей изменений, если заполнена).
Когда отправляется: при сохранении релиза в Панели администратора, в случае выполнения следующих условий: - включён флаг "Отправить уведомление", - включен флаг "Релиз активен", - дата релиза не в будущем - в настройках «Почта и уведомления» включён глобальный флаг «Оповещать пользователей о выходе нового релиза».
Конкретный пользователь может не получать уведомление о релизе, если в настройках его Личного кабинета включен флаг "Получать уведомления о выходе новых релизов".
3. license_expiring_soon - напоминание о скором окончании подписки
Тема по умолчанию:
Срок действия подписки {{ product.name }} истекает {{ serial.expiry_date }}
Назначение: напоминание за N дней до окончания подписки (количество дней задаётся в настройках «Уведомления об окончании подписки»).
Когда отправляется: по расписанию, за заданное число дней до даты окончания лицензии.
4. license_expired - уведомление о фактическом завершении подписки
Тема по умолчанию:
Срок действия лицензии {{ product.name }} истек
Назначение: уведомление о фактическом завершении подписки.
Когда отправляется: в день окончания лицензии (если включён соответствующий флажок в настройках уведомлений).
5. new_serial - выдача нового серийного номера
Тема по умолчанию:
Ваш серийный номер для лицензии {{ serial.product }}
Назначение: отправка клиенту нового серийного номера и краткой информации о лицензии.
Когда отправляется: при создании/выдаче новой лицензии ПО с серийным номером.
6. new_user_invite - оповещение пользователя о добавлении его аккаунта на портал
Тема по умолчанию:
Вы зарегистрированы на портале {{ license_owner.site_url }}
Назначение: оповещение нового пользователя о возможности доступа на портал; в письме содержатся ссылка и данные для входа.
Когда отправляется: при создании пользователя в Панели администратора.
7. password_reset - восстановление пароля
Тема по умолчанию:
Восстановление пароля
Назначение: письмо со ссылкой для восстановления пароля на портале.
Когда отправляется: после запроса «Не помню пароль» на странице входа в Личный кабинет.
8. user_profile_changed - уведомление об изменении профиля
Тема по умолчанию:
Изменение профиля пользователя {{ user.email }}
Назначение: уведомление пользователю о том, что его профиль был изменен (например, имя, фамилия, контактные данные).
Когда отправляется: после изменения профиля в личном кабинете.
Примеры использования переменных полей
В шаблонах используются переменные поля вида {{ ... }}, которые подставляются автоматически. Список доступных полей приведен внизу каждого шаблона
Эти переменные можно использовать как в поле «Тема», так и в «HTML-шаблон» каждого письма, адаптируя формулировки под конкретный продукт и стиль компании.